» Church Locks Out Commercial Sex Workers From New Year Eve Service «

In what is reminiscent of the biblical five foolish virgins
who were locked out of the feast of the bridegroom,
commercial sex workers hoping to get into church late for
prayers ringing in the New Year were shut out by security
at the Sacred Heart Cathedral in Akure on Thursday.
Many prostitutes who had attempted to sneak in for last
minute grace got the shock of their lives as they were
prevented from entering the church by the gatemen.
TheSunshineTimes.com gathered that there are many
brothels around the Sacred Heart Cathedral which cater to
the needs of men in search of quick sexual favours. It is
the custom of the ladies to make a late dash into the
church in order to crossover into the new year.
However, this year would be different and the
incident caused a bit of commotion at the gate as many
other people including revellers from adjoining bars were
also affected by the action of the gate men who were
trying to ensure that people with deadly weapons did not
sneak into the service to cause harm to the congregation.
One of the security men was heard murmuring: “Na God
catch dem today. Dem too like to always rush into church
at dying minute. Where dem dey before, yeye people.”
Some of the affected ladies, however, told
TheSunshineTimes.com that it was their personal
business to come to church at their own time.
“They should not stop us from entering at any time we like,
this is God’s house for crying out loud,” said a lady who
simply identified herself as Tina.
Eventually, those bent on crossing over into the new year
in a place of worship had to find alternatives at other
churches close by.
